    Hey so I would like to ask the community -

    What are the top 10 tips or advice you tell new players to help them when they start PL?

    I'm just making a list so that I can help new players when they start playing.

    Here's some of mine for example:
    1. dont give out your email or password
    2. you can buy potions for gold from Ellie
    (Join a tier 3 guild to get them cheaper)
    3. buy weapons or equipment from cs at balefort castle - add them and invite them)
    4. you can also make gold by selling weapons and equipment at cs
    5. get all the free platinum offers
    6. dont beg / dont scam
    7. pinks are best, then purples
    8. how to guild chat
    9. how to kill enemies including combos
    10. how to add skills, skill points, and attributes and what effect that has

    That's just some of many - what are yours?

    12. If someone bothers you, mute them and move on
    13. Items can also be liquidated for fast gold
    14. Don't be afraid to invite high levels to your game if you really need help, but always be polite. If you say "join me" or "level me" they're less likely to help than if you said "do you think that you could help me defeat this boss?"
    15. Join the forums!
